excel计算结果怎么四舍五入取整数

excel计算结果怎么四舍五入取整数

Excel中的四舍五入取整数有多种方法,包括使用ROUND函数、INT函数、以及ROUNDUP和ROUNDDOWN函数。 其中,ROUND函数是最常用的,因为它可以精确地控制小数点后的位数。INT函数则用于直接取整,向下取最接近的整数。ROUNDUP和ROUNDDOWN函数分别用于向上和向下取整。接下来,我们将详细介绍这些方法,并提供实际应用中的一些技巧和注意事项。

一、使用ROUND函数

ROUND函数是Excel中最常用来进行四舍五入的方法。其语法为ROUND(number, num_digits),其中number是要四舍五入的数字,num_digits是要保留的小数位数。当num_digits为0时,表示四舍五入到最接近的整数。

例如:

=ROUND(4.56, 0)  // 结果为5

=ROUND(4.44, 0) // 结果为4

1. 应用场景

ROUND函数适用于需要精确控制小数位数的场景,例如财务报表、统计数据等。

2. 注意事项

在使用ROUND函数时,要注意四舍五入的规则:当小数点后的位数大于等于5时,向上取整;小于5时,向下取整。

二、使用INT函数

INT函数用于将数字向下取整,即取最接近的、不大于原数的整数。其语法为INT(number),其中number是要取整的数字。

例如:

=INT(4.56)  // 结果为4

=INT(-4.56) // 结果为-5

1. 应用场景

INT函数适用于需要向下取整的场景,例如计算工作天数、处理负数等。

2. 注意事项

在使用INT函数时,要注意负数的处理方式:INT函数总是向下取整,即使是负数。

三、使用ROUNDUP和ROUNDDOWN函数

ROUNDUP函数用于向上取整,即总是向上取最接近的整数。其语法为ROUNDUP(number, num_digits),其中number是要取整的数字,num_digits是要保留的小数位数。当num_digits为0时,表示向上取整到最接近的整数。

例如:

=ROUNDUP(4.44, 0)  // 结果为5

=ROUNDUP(-4.44, 0) // 结果为-4

ROUNDDOWN函数用于向下取整,即总是向下取最接近的整数。其语法与ROUNDUP函数类似。

例如:

=ROUNDDOWN(4.56, 0)  // 结果为4

=ROUNDDOWN(-4.56, 0) // 结果为-5

1. 应用场景

ROUNDUP和ROUNDDOWN函数适用于需要明确控制取整方向的场景,例如计算加班工资、调整库存数量等。

2. 注意事项

在使用ROUNDUP和ROUNDDOWN函数时,要根据实际需求选择合适的函数,以避免计算误差。

四、综合应用技巧

1. 使用组合函数

在实际应用中,有时需要结合多个函数来实现复杂的取整需求。例如,可以结合IF函数ROUND函数,根据不同条件选择取整方式。

=IF(A1 > 0, ROUNDUP(A1, 0), ROUNDDOWN(A1, 0))

2. 数学运算

除了使用内置函数,还可以通过数学运算实现取整。例如,使用INT(number + 0.5)来实现四舍五入。

=INT(4.56 + 0.5)  // 结果为5

=INT(4.44 + 0.5) // 结果为4

3. 数据验证

在处理大批量数据时,可以使用数据验证功能,确保输入的数据符合取整规则。例如,可以设置数据验证规则,只允许输入整数。

五、总结

通过以上几种方法,我们可以灵活地在Excel中实现四舍五入取整数的需求。具体方法包括ROUND函数、INT函数、ROUNDUP和ROUNDDOWN函数,以及结合IF函数和数学运算等。每种方法都有其适用的场景和注意事项,选择合适的方法可以有效提高工作效率,减少计算误差。无论是财务报表、统计数据,还是日常工作中的数据处理,掌握这些技巧都能让我们更加得心应手。

相关问答FAQs:

1. 如何在Excel中将计算结果四舍五入取整数?
在Excel中,您可以使用ROUND函数来实现四舍五入取整数。该函数的语法如下: ROUND(数值, 小数位数)。例如,如果您想将A1单元格中的计算结果四舍五入到整数位数,可以使用以下公式:ROUND(A1, 0)。

2. 我该如何将Excel中的计算结果向上取整数?
如果您希望将计算结果向上取整数,可以使用CEILING函数。该函数的语法如下:CEILING(数值, 大于或等于的倍数)。例如,如果您想将A1单元格中的计算结果向上取整到最接近的10的倍数,可以使用以下公式:CEILING(A1, 10)。

3. 如何将Excel中的计算结果向下取整数?
如果您希望将计算结果向下取整数,可以使用FLOOR函数。该函数的语法如下:FLOOR(数值, 小于或等于的倍数)。例如,如果您想将A1单元格中的计算结果向下取整到最接近的10的倍数,可以使用以下公式:FLOOR(A1, 10)。

请注意,在使用这些函数时,要根据实际需要选择合适的小数位数或倍数。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4439183

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部